What is Terminal Emulation?
Terminal emulation software replicates the functionality of a physical terminal – a device that allows users to communicate with computers through text-based interfaces. These software emulators recreate the experience of a physical terminal, providing a text-based window where users can type commands, receive responses, and interact with remote servers and legacy applications.
How it Works:
Imagine a time before graphical user interfaces (GUIs), when users interacted with computers solely through typed commands. This was the realm of text-based terminals, devices connected to mainframes or servers. Terminal emulators recreate this environment on modern computers. They emulate the specific protocols and behaviors of the original terminals, enabling communication with older systems.
Benefits of Terminal Emulation:
- Access to Legacy Systems: Terminal emulators provide a crucial gateway to access and interact with legacy applications and data stored on older systems. This is essential for tasks like managing databases, running historical scripts, or retrieving crucial information.
- Remote Access: Terminal emulators enable users to connect to remote servers and systems, offering remote administration and control even when physically separated from the target machine.
- Security: Terminal emulation often employs secure protocols like SSH, ensuring secure communication and data transmission, especially when accessing sensitive information on remote servers.
- Simplicity: While graphical interfaces can be complex, terminal emulators offer a streamlined and efficient way to interact with systems through simple text-based commands.
Popular Terminal Emulators:
Several popular terminal emulators cater to different needs and platforms. Some of the most widely used include:
- PuTTY: A versatile open-source terminal emulator for Windows, supporting various protocols like SSH, Telnet, and RLogin.
- SecureCRT: A commercial terminal emulator known for its robust features and compatibility with various protocols.
- iTerm2: A powerful and customizable terminal emulator for macOS, offering advanced features and customization options.
